Test Principle: The test principle applied in this kit is Sandwich enzyme immunoassay. The microtiter plate provided in this kit has been pre-coated with an antibody specific to Small Ubiquitin Related Modifier Protein 1 (SUMO1) . Standards or samples are added to the appropriate microtiter plate wells then with a biotin-conjugated antibody specific to Small Ubiquitin Related Modifier Protein 1 (SUMO1) . Next, Avidin conjugated to Horseradish Peroxidase (HRP) is added to each microplate well and incubated. After TMB substrate solution is added, only those wells that contain Small Ubiquitin Related Modifier Protein 1 (SUMO1), biotin-conjugated antibody and enzyme-conjugated Avidin will exhibit a change in color. The enzyme-substrate reaction is terminated by the addition of sulphuric acid solution and the color change is measured spectrophotometrically at a wavelength of 450nm ± 10nm. The concentration of Small Ubiquitin Related Modifier Protein 1 (SUMO1) in the samples is then determined by comparing the OD of the samples to the standard curve.
